Doors made of fiberglass and steel are less prone to warping and rotting than wood
There are a lot of options available when it comes to replacing your door. The most well-known materials are wood and steel. Each has advantages and disadvantages. However, fiberglass and steel are less likely to warp or rot than wooden doors. These two types of materials can aid in saving money over the long run.
Wood is the most popular material for exterior doors. However, composite door glass replacement it is not as efficient as fiberglass or steel. Wood requires to be maintained and repaired regularly. It's very easy to harm wood when moisture isn't sealed correctly.
Fiberglass is a fantastic choice for homes that are exposed to extreme weather conditions. It is resistant to rot, rust, and warping. Fiberglass doors are more durable and insulated as compared to wooden and metal doors.
Fiberglass is also extremely durable, because it can last for a long time with minimal maintenance. This makes it a good option for homeowners concerned about energy efficiency.
Steel is a tough door material however it can be susceptible to scratches, dents and corrosion. It can also become very hot when it is exposed to extreme temperatures. These problems can cause a decrease in the life expectancy of your door.
Steel doors can look just like wood , but it is possible to make them appear more rustic. Some homeowners prefer to stain or paint their doors. Others prefer buying doors that have an organic look.

Patio doors are smaller and thinner than doors for exterior use.
There are plenty of factors to think about when selecting the right patio doors for your home. These include design as well as energy efficiency and maintenance. The aesthetics of your home could also be affected by the materials you use for its construction. There are many options to pick from. It is crucial to pick the right door for your house. Not only will it impact the aesthetics of your home however, it will also enhance the structural integrity of the house.
If you're looking for an affordable alternative, upvc door replacement doors could be the best choice for you. They are energy efficient and are simple to install. Unlike other types of doors, uPVC is durable and low-maintenance. You can be sure that you are getting a the most value for money.
Sliding doors are yet another popular option. This kind of door can be opened from both sides to give you a view of your garden. However, it's important to ensure that all of the glass is safe glass. Otherwise, you run the risk of injury when the glass breaks.
A hinged patio door is a good option for those who want an elegant look. Sidelights are commonly used to complement this type of door. Sidelights are small stationary panels made of glass and are designed to be placed near the door. You can also opt for a bi-fold or sliding door to gain more space.
